Burton Stephen Lancaster (November 2, 1913 – October 20, 1994) was an American actor and film producer. Initially known for playing tough guys with a tender heart, he went on to achieve success with more complex and challenging roles over a 45-year career in films and television series.

Burt Lancaster, American film actor who projected a unique combination of physical toughness and emotional vulnerability. His movies included The Killers, I Walk Alone, From Here to Eternity, Gunfight at the O.K. Corral, Elmer Gantry, Birdman of Alcatraz, Seven Days in May, Atlantic City, and Field of Dreams.
